are you saying that the translation she did was not actually rigtht and the transmission said something else!?

 

Well it is a bit debatable - she got the general idea but the interesting thing is in the word used in - "it killed them all". What was said in French was "il" which normally means "he". It could just be a weird way of referring to a male thing but if (and people will probably debate this with me) I wanted to say that a weird beasty had killed everyone I would say "ca" which is translated as "it". But as I say it was just something that grabbed me at the time and only when I sit and think about it could it have several meanings.
